Considerations for Walking Inflatable Character
- Space Requirements and Clearance
- Before setting up a walking inflatable character, it is essential to consider the available space. The area should be large enough to accommodate the character’s movement and any associated activities. There should be sufficient clearance around the character to prevent collisions with objects or people. If used indoors, ensure that the ceiling height is adequate to allow for the full range of motion. A flat and stable surface is also crucial for proper functioning.
- Power Source and Electrical Safety
- The walking inflatable character requires a power source to operate the motorized walking system and any other electrical components such as speakers or sensors. Ensure that there is access to a reliable power outlet and use appropriate electrical cords and connectors. It is vital to follow electrical safety standards to prevent electrical hazards. Regularly check the power cords and connections for any signs of damage or wear.
- Maintenance and Repairs
- Like any inflatable attraction, a walking inflatable character needs regular maintenance. After each use, deflate and inspect the character for any tears, punctures, or damage to the fabric or moving parts. The motors and mechanical systems should be lubricated and checked for proper functioning. Any repairs should be carried out promptly using the appropriate tools and replacement parts. Store the character in a clean and dry place when not inuse to protect it from environmental damage.
- Operator Training and Supervision
- If the walking inflatable character is used in a public or commercial setting, trained operators are essential. They need to understand how to set up, operate, and shut down the character safely. They should also be trained in handling any potential malfunctions or emergencies. During operation, proper supervision is required to ensure the safety of the audience and to prevent any misuse or damage to the character.
